Indonesia and the Philippines stand out in Southeast Asia as countries where generals – not health experts – lead their coronavirus response. Read this in-depth story by paterno_II

REMINDER. Mask-clad Indonesian soldiers and police walk with placards to remind members of the public about social distancing measures amid the coronavirus pandemic, at the Tanah Abang textile market in Jakarta on June 9, 2020. Photo by Adek Berry/AFP

Chaula Rininta Anindya, research analyst at the S. Rajaratnam School of International Studies in Singapore, shares the same view about military men withholding information on COVID-19. KEEPING WATCH. Indonesian military personnel, stationed to enforce health protocol discipline, man a counter at the Husein Sastranegara airport in Bandung, West Java, on May 29, 2020, amid the coronavirus pandemic.
